学习Java ME的步骤

流程图

st=>start: 开始
op1=>operation: 学习Java基础
op2=>operation: 下载和安装Java ME SDK
op3=>operation: 创建一个Java ME项目
op4=>operation: 编写Java ME代码
op5=>operation: 调试和运行Java ME应用
e=>end: 完成

st->op1->op2->op3->op4->op5->e

步骤详解

步骤1:学习Java基础

在学习Java ME之前,你需要先掌握Java的基础知识。这包括Java的语法、面向对象编程、异常处理等。你可以通过阅读Java相关的教程、书籍或参加培训课程来学习Java基础知识。

步骤2:下载和安装Java ME SDK

Java ME SDK是用于开发Java ME应用的开发工具包。你可以从Oracle官网上下载Java ME SDK,并按照官方的安装说明进行安装。安装完成后,你可以启动Java ME SDK,开始创建和编写Java ME应用。

步骤3:创建一个Java ME项目

在Java ME SDK中,你可以创建一个新的Java ME项目。打开Java ME SDK,点击菜单中的"File",然后选择"New Project"。在弹出的对话框中,选择"Java ME Project",然后点击"Next"。在接下来的对话框中,填写项目的名称和保存路径,然后点击"Finish"。

步骤4:编写Java ME代码

在Java ME项目中,你可以编写Java ME代码。在项目的src文件夹下,可以创建和编辑Java ME类文件。以下是一个简单的Java ME应用的示例代码:

import javax.microedition.midlet.*;
import javax.microedition.lcdui.*;

public class HelloWorld extends MIDlet implements CommandListener {
   private Display display;
   private Form form;
   private Command exitCommand;

   public HelloWorld() {
      display = Display.getDisplay(this);
      form = new Form("HelloWorld");
      exitCommand = new Command("Exit", Command.EXIT, 0);
      form.addCommand(exitCommand);
      form.setCommandListener(this);
   }

   public void startApp() {
      display.setCurrent(form);
   }

   public void pauseApp() {
   }

   public void destroyApp(boolean unconditional) {
   }

   public void commandAction(Command c, Displayable s) {
      if (c == exitCommand) {
         destroyApp(true);
         notifyDestroyed();
      }
   }
}

这个示例代码定义了一个名为"HelloWorld"的Java ME应用,它创建了一个包含一个退出按钮的表单。当点击退出按钮时,应用会退出。你可以根据自己的需求修改和扩展这个示例代码。

步骤5:调试和运行Java ME应用

在Java ME SDK中,你可以调试和运行Java ME应用。首先,选择你的Java ME项目,在菜单中选择"Run",然后点击"Run Project"。Java ME SDK会将应用打包并在模拟器中运行。你可以在模拟器中测试和调试应用的功能和性能。

总结

通过按照以上步骤,你可以学习和实践Java ME开发。首先,你需要掌握Java基础知识,然后下载和安装Java ME SDK。接下来,你可以创建一个Java ME项目,并编写Java ME代码。最后,你可以在Java ME SDK中调试和运行你的应用。祝你学习Java ME的过程顺利!